So, let's get straight to it—why is self-discipline so darn important? Well, think of it as the compass that guides you toward your North Star, your goals and dreams. Without self-discipline, that compass goes haywire, and you end up lost in the wilderness of distractions.
Studies have shown that people with strong self-discipline tend to be more successful in various aspects of life. They achieve their goals, manage their time effectively, and stay focused on what truly matters. But it's not just about success; it's also about personal growth and happiness.
You see, self-discipline isn't about depriving yourself of pleasures; it's about delaying gratification. It's the ability to say no to instant pleasures for the sake of long-term gain. It's about making choices that align with your values and goals.
All right, so we know self-discipline is vital, but why is it so darn challenging? Well, my friends, life has a way of throwing hurdles our way. Let's talk about some common obstacles to self-discipline.
Instant Gratification: We live in a world of instant everything—food delivery, streaming, online shopping. It's easy to fall into the trap of seeking immediate rewards, even if they don't serve our long-term goals.
Lack of Motivation: Ever had a day where you just didn't feel like doing anything productive? We all have those moments. Motivation can be elusive, and when it's absent, self-discipline becomes a Herculean task.
Distractions: In our hyper-connected world, distractions are everywhere. Social media, endless emails, Netflix—these are all siren calls that can lure us away from our goals.
Procrastination: Ah, the old procrastination bug. It's like a friendly monster that whispers, "You can do it later." And later turns into never.
Now, let's talk solutions, because what's a problem without a solution, right? Here are some practical tips to boost your self-discipline:
Set Clear Goals: Define your goals with precision. When you have a crystal-clear destination in mind, it's easier to stay on the path.
Chunk It Down: Break your goals into smaller, manageable tasks. It's less overwhelming and provides a sense of accomplishment with each step.
Create a Routine: Establishing a daily routine can help automate self-discipline. It becomes a habit, making it less reliant on motivation.
Eliminate Distractions: Identify your distractions and take steps to minimize them. Consider using website blockers or turning off notifications.
Accountability: Share your goals with a friend or a mentor who can hold you accountable. Sometimes, a gentle nudge from someone else can do wonders.
Practice Mindfulness: Being mindful of your impulses and desires can help you make conscious choices that align with your goals.
